GlobalBind -list|-clear|-delete <name>|<name> <combo> <command>
Forms
- Global Binds are just like Bind except they create windows hotkeys usable from anywhere to send commands to your InnerSpace Session
- GlobalBind -list - lists all your registered global hotkeys
- GlobalBind -clear - clears all your global hotkeys
- GlobalBind -delete <name> - deletes a global hotkey
- GlobalBind <name> <combo> <command> - creates a global hotkey of <name> using <combo> keys to execute <command>
